Obituary of Charles E. Shauger
Charles E. Shauger died suddenly on February 15, 2025. He was 59 years old.
The son of the late Hank Shauger and Mary Verrelli, he was born on January 29, 1966 in Port Jervis NY.
Charles was a passionate hunter and fisherman, who spent many hours outdoors with his family and friends. He enjoyed driving anything with wheels, including his ATVs or just a long scenic ride. Charles was a respected firefighter, serving as a Captain with Cuddebackville Fire Department for 15 years, and Sparrowbush as a firefighter for 23 years. He spent countless hours protecting and serving his community. Charles worked for Rohrer Bus company, DPW of Westfall Township and Combined Energy Service. Charles loved his kids and grandkids. He would give the shirt off his back to anyone in need, following in his mother's footsteps.
In addition to his parents Charles was predeceased in life by his step father Tony Verrelli and mother in law Charlotte DeGroat.
Beloved husband of Susan Shauger. Proud father of Bryan Shauger (Katarina), Matthew Shauger (Austin), Scott Shauger (Samantha), and Dylan Shauger. Dear brother of Joie Ogrodnick and Henry Shauger. Grandfather of Evalina, Logan, Matthew Jr., Bryson, Jameson, Jaxon, Aurora, Colton and Austyn. Son in law of Harold DeGroat. Cherished uncle and great uncle of many nieces and nephews.
A celebration of life will take place on Sunday 2/23 from 12:00PM to 3:00PM at the Sparrowbush Fire Department 79 Main Street Sparrowbush NY 12780.
Private funeral and cremation services entrusted to Knight-Auchmoody Funeral Home of Port Jervis, NY.
